Meta ships Muse agent for email, payments, and travel
S
1:24speaker_0HOST
That follows a funding round Reuters previously said would value DeepSeek at about five hundred billion yuan, roughly seventy-five billion dollars.
S
1:33speaker_0HOST
In June, the startup raised about seven point four billion dollars at a post-money valuation above fifty billion, with founder Liang Wenfeng personally committing twenty billion yuan and Tencent plus CATL among the largest external shareholders.
S
1:48speaker_0HOST
Chinese peers Z.AI and MiniMax already listed in Hong Kong, while Moonshot has filed confidentially for a Hong Kong IPO.
